The idea that the trailer stability assist works without the car knowing the trailer is connected. Dealer explained to me that the functions that underly TSA, namely electronic stability control, work all the time (obviously). When the car senses that a trailer is connected it switches to a different program designed to better deal with a swaying trailer.
Several other features are also switched on by the car when it senses the trailer is present:
- trailer indication on the dash
- reversing warning alarm muted
- air suspension will not change height while travelling at speed
Ergo, in my case, these functions and the enhanced form of ESC known as trailer stability assist, appear not to be working.
